Nursery painting is an essential aspect of preparing a welcoming and nurturing environment for a newborn. It involves selecting calming and soothing colors that promote relaxation and comfort for both the baby and the parents. The right choice of colors and designs can significantly impact the mood and atmosphere of the nursery, creating a space that feels safe, warm, and inviting. Additionally, nursery painting can be a reflection of personal style and preferences, allowing parents to create a unique and personalized space for their child. By considering factors such as color psychology and the overall theme of the nursery, parents can ensure that the environment supports their child's development and well-being.
Benefits of Nursery Painting
-
Enhances Mood and Atmosphere
The colors and designs chosen for a nursery can greatly influence the mood and atmosphere of the room. Soft, pastel shades are often used to create a calming and serene environment, which can help soothe a baby and promote better sleep patterns. By carefully selecting the right hues, parents can create a peaceful space that supports their child's emotional well-being. -
Stimulates Early Development
Nursery painting can play a crucial role in a child's early development. Bright and engaging colors can stimulate a baby's visual senses and encourage curiosity and exploration. Incorporating elements such as patterns or murals can provide visual stimulation that aids in cognitive development and helps foster a sense of wonder and discovery. -
Reflects Personal Style and Preferences
Painting a nursery allows parents to express their personal style and preferences, making the space feel unique and personalized. Whether opting for a classic look with soft tones or a more vibrant and modern design, nursery painting provides an opportunity to create a room that resonates with the family's aesthetic and values.
